Key facts about Ohtuvayre
What is Ohtuvayre?
Ohtuvayre (ensifentrine) is an inhalation suspension used in COPD.
What dosages is Ohtuvayre available in?
Ohtuvayre is available as a 3 mg/2.5 mL suspension in unit-dose ampules.
What is Ohtuvayre used for?
Ohtuvayre is a phosphodiesterase 3 (PDE3) inhibitor and phosphodiesterase 4 (PDE4) inhibitor used for the maintenance treatment of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) in adults.
How does Ohtuvayre work?
Ohtuvayre blocks two proteins in the body called PDE3 and PDE4. By blocking these proteins, the medicine helps relax the muscles around the airways in the lungs. This helps to reduce COPD symptoms such as coughing, wheezing, and shortness of breath.
How do I take Ohtuvayre?
Ohtuvayre is typically dosed as 3 mg (one ampule) twice daily given by oral inhalation using a standard jet nebulizer with a mouthpiece.

Ohtuvayre Common Side Effects
Common side effects of Ohtuvayre: Back pain, Increased blood pressure, Urinary tract infections, Diarrhea
Ohtuvayre Serious Side Effects
Serious side effects are rare with Ohtuvayre. Contact your healthcare provider immediately if you experience any of the following: Allergic reactions: skin rash, itching, hives, sw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at Mood and behavior changes: anxiety, nervousness, confusion, hallucinations, irritability, hostility, thoughts of suicide or self-harm, worsening mood, feelings of depression Wheezing or trouble breathing that is worse after use
